如何调用默认的zsh执行git log --grep命令?而不是调用git来执行

2013-02-08 22:33:02 +08:00
 walkingway
因为用的是zsh + “oh-my-zsh” 所以执行grep匹配结果会有高亮显示,而执行git log --grep="..."的时候,结果是调用git来执行,结果无高亮,请问如何设置才能用默认的zsh来执行git log --grep="..."
3537 次点击
所在节点    问与答
4 条回复
xell
2013-02-09 04:03:56 +08:00
你可以试试看在 gitconfig 中设置 color.grep=auto
walkingway
2013-02-09 11:30:49 +08:00
@xell git config --global color.grep auto
我这样设置了以后,不知道为啥,在git log --grep里还是没有高亮。。。
xell
2013-02-09 12:04:28 +08:00
我的 .zshrc 里面,plugins=(git 以及其他),你看看这个设定有作用么?
walkingway
2013-02-09 12:21:43 +08:00
@xell plugins=(git ...我刚试了下 g log,起作用,去掉plugins里的git就认不出g log,看来这个插件起作用的。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/60120

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X